The research was carried out on the experimental field of Ulyanovsk State Agrarian University named after P.A. Stolypin. The materials (objects) were zeolite from Yushanskoye deposit in Ulyanovsk region; zeolite enriched with amino acids; Saratovskoye 12 common millet. The scheme of the experiment included 4 variants: 1 - control, 2 - zeolite 500 kg/ha, 3 - zeolite enriched with amino acids, 500 kg/ha, 4 - N40P40K40. The area of the record plot was 20 m2 (2*10), fourfold repetition. The soil of the experimental field is leached black soil with low humus content (3.8-4.0%), high mobile phosphorus content (150 mg/kg by Chirikov), increased content of exchangeable potassium (89 mg/kg), a slightly acidic reaction of soil solution (pHKCl of 5.5 units). The experiments were carried out with strict adherence to all methodological requirements, analyzes were conducted according to relevant state standards. It was established that zeolite of Yushansky deposit of Ulyanovsk region and fertilizer based on it, enriched with amino acids, have a positive effect on leached black soil properties: agrophysical state of the arable layer improved (the content of agronomically valuable aggregates increased by 11.4-11.5%); overall biological activity increased (by 15-32%); the content of phosphorus available to plants increased by 27-38 mg/kg, potassium by 11-12 mg/kg, mineral forms of nitrogen by 13.1 and 8.9 mg/kg, silicon by 10.7 and 10.9 mg/kg of soil. The increase of millet grain yield in case of application of pure zeolite was 0.40 t/ha (16%), in case of zeolite enriched with amino acids - 0.93 t/ha (37%). It presents the results of studies on evaluation of technological properties of the udder of cows as a whole for the herd and in the context of the main lines. The studies showed that in the herd of purebred Simmental cattle of SPK \"Abodimovskiy\" 52.2% of cows have a bowl-shaped udder, including 64.7% for first-calf heifers. Significant differences in the uddershape were established between the representatives belonging to Rezvyi 1016 and Florian 374 lines. Among the cows of Rezvyi 1016 line, 80.9% of animals hada cup-shaped udderin the first lactation, which is 9.5% more than among cows of Florian 374 line. As forthe second and third lactations, the difference in favor of the cows of Rezvyi 1016 line was 8.3 and 8.6%, and on average for all lactations by 11.3%. According to measurements of length, width, udder girth and depth of the fore quarters, depending on the age during lactations, cows which belong to Rezvyi 1016 line were superior to their peers of Florian 374 line by 0.9-3.0; 1.0-2.3; 3.0-5.2 and 1.1-2.0 cm, and in terms of udder volume and milk flow intensity, this superiority was 0.30-0.70 dc3 and 0.06-0.09 kg/min. The relation between the intensity of milk flow and daily milk yield is most pronounced for cows of Rezvyi 1016 line (r = + 0.479). This relation in Florian line was only r = + 0.281. The correlation coefficient between milk yield of cows for the first lactation and the volume of the udder ofRezvyi 1016 line was r = + 0.45, and of Florian 374 line only r = + 0.23, which is 0.22 units lower. Salina). Decapsulated eggs and live Artemianauplii, which have a high nutritional value and a necessary set of biologically active substances, are widely used in cultivation of fish larvae. Biological characteristics of Artemia, such as rapid growth, high fecundity, the amount of cysts that are preserved and stored, contributed to its commercialization. The demand for Artemia eggs is growing from year to year in the world market, but the volume of their production in natural reservoirs supplies only 40% of the demand. The missing volumes of Artemia can be satisfied by artificial reproduction in aquaculture. The purpose of our research was to assess the factors that regulate the ontogeny and productivity of A. Salina in aquaculture. The results of the research showed that the cultivation conditions we created, such as270Ctemperature, illumination intensity of 1500 lux, saturation of the environment with oxygen (SO2) - 90%, pH 8.2,provided 82% hatching of nauplii within the first day, and the hatching increased and reached 96-97% on the second day. Experimentally selected abiotic and biotic factors that determine the effectiveness of Artemiacultivation have shown fairly good results. Analysis of literature sources and our own data showed that it is not enough to improve abiotic and biotic factors inn case of in vitro cultivationin order to obtain high productivity of Artemia, first of all, it is necessary to have high-quality material - Artemia cysts or eggs, which should belocallyproduced, cultivating Artemia in a closed cycle. Zaremuk","doi":"10.18286/1816-4501-2022-3-97-102","DOIUrl":"https://doi.org/10.18286/1816-4501-2022-3-97-102","url":null,"abstract":"The article presents results of the study of domestic and introduced varieties of sweet cherry in Prikubanskaya garden zone of the Krasnodar Territory in the conditions of temperature stressimpact in the spring period from 2014 to 2021. Since sweet cherry is a rather specific stone fruit crop, whichproductivity is closely dependent on abiotic factors, its cultivation is limited mainly to the southern regions. The purpose of the study was to assess the adaptability of sweet cherry varieties, different in ecological, geographical and genetic origin, to spring stress factors. A yieldvariation of sweet cherry varieties in the south of Russia over the yearswas revealed,it varied from single fruits to 65 kg per treedepending on stressors in the spring period. A close relation (r = 0.855) was established between the yield of varieties and negative temperatures in April, the impact of which leads to yield decrease by 80-90%. The purpose of the research was to study indirect parametres used for assessing winter soft wheat grain qualityin terms of varietal profile and crop as a whole. The objectives of the research were to establish the formationfeatures of grain quality parametres of winter soft wheat, the correlations between them, as well as correlations with the yield of the studied crop. The material for the research was 15 varieties of winter soft wheat, included in the State Register of Breeding Achievements, approved for use in the Middle Volga region. It was established that dry conditions during formation of winter wheat grain and its filling had a positive effect on gluten content and hardness, and in combination with high temperatures - on glutenquality. The grain-unit of winter wheat grain increases in the conditions of sufficient moisture. There are no statistically significant inverse relations between yield and grain quality parametres of winter soft wheat: the quantity and quality of gluten, grain hardness, which means that they can be combined in one genotype. The grain-unit of grain can significantly positively correlate with the yield and hardness of grain of the studied crop in some years. All considered parametres of grain quality of winter soft wheat significantly depend on the variety (contribution of 5.2-32.7%), environmental conditions (contribution of 24.5-85.4%) and the interaction of the genotype and the environment (contribution of 5.4-42, 5 %). The productivity of natural forage lands is influenced by seasonal fluctuations in temperature and precipitation, especially characteristic of the steppe Orenburg region. The uneven intra-annual distribution of precipitation does not meet the water needs of the phytocenosis in the vegetative phase of development. The aim of the study was to analyze the effect of atmospheric precipitation on agricultural forage lands of Orenburg region. An important and necessary task is to assess the interaction of agro-climatic factors on the development of agricultural land is an important and necessary task. The research area is located in a zone with a semiarid (semi-arid) climate of temperate latitudes of the Orenburg Urals of the Orenburg region (Orenburg region, Russia). Studies of agricultural land were carried out on 4 plots in the vicinity of the village of Nezhinka, Orenburg district, Orenburg region. For this purpose, various facies of agricultural lands located on the supports of watershed surfaces are identified and analyzed. To study local geosystems of various facies, we used camera methods, aerospace images and in-kind observations. Statistical and mathematical processing of digital data was carried out according to the StatsoftStatisticav 6.1 RUS program. Elements of descriptive statistics of average annual indicators (total precipitation per year, precipitation during the growing season, productivity of natural lands) revealed that the theory of normality was not rejected. The analysis of the average long-term data on the amount of precipitation and their relationship with the productivity of natural forage lands shows a reliable positive correlation between these parameters, at r2 = 0.95. The aim of the research is to determine the effect of elements of cultivation technology on yield and quality of winter wheat seeds on light gray forest soils in the southeast of the Volga-Vyatka region. The field experiment was based on a three-factor scheme: varieties of winter wheat (Moskovskaya 40, Moskovskaya 56, Moskovskaya 82, Nemchinovskaya 17, Nemchinovskaya 57, Moskovskaya 39 (standard)); sowing dates: the first - August 25-26, the second - September 10-11, the third - September 25-26 and seeding amount - 6.0; 4.5; 3.0 million v.s. (million viable seeds). Well-known generally accepted methods were used during the experiment. It was established that the field germination of seeds varied by the variants of the experiment at the first sowing period from 64.7 to 83.0%, at the second period from 67.4 to 75.9%, at the third period from 46.4 to 70.3%. It was determined that the conditions for overwintering of plants of the studied culture were generally satisfactory and, in terms of sowing time (in a ten-point system), varied within 7.85-8.37; 7.08-7.55; 6.44-7.18 points, respectively. It was found that the number of plants of the studied crop per 1 m2 before harvesting changed according to the sowing time as follows: in the first period from 130 to 186 pcs.; in the second period from 117 to 163 pieces and in the third period from 93 to 141 pcs. It was revealed that the sowing time had the greatest impact on winter wheat yield. On average for 2017-2021, the first of them stood out significantly average yield was 7.47, 5.66; 4.86 t/ha, respectively, in terms of sowing. When studying the seeding amount of winter wheat seeds, it was noted that, on average, at all three seeding amounts, the yield changed slightly and at a seeding amount of 6.0 million v.s. was 6.26 t/ha, at 4.5 million v.s. – 5.96 t/ha, at 3.0 million v.s. – 5.74 t/ha. It was determined that the most adapted varieties were Moskovskaya 56, Nemchinovskaya 57, Moskovskaya 82. Their average yield for three sowing times was 6.26, respectively; 6.29; 6.31 t/ha, which is by 13.2; 13.7 and 14.1% more than the standard (Moskovskaya 39). For productive animal husbandry, the study of genetic and environmental factors in consumption of metabolic energy is the most important. The purpose of this work was a comparative study of the main processes of metabolic energy usage of mammals and birds, as well as their interaction and influence on productive qualities. The study was carried out on breeding farms and poultry farms on cows and chickens, similar in terms of rearing methods, age and housing technologies. The study adopted a single assessment of the studied phenomena, in MJ, characterizing the energy, released heat, and the work performed per day for the synthesis of products. Statistical analysis of energy inflow and outflow allowedto determine the direction of this relation and the level of their influence on animal productivity. As a result of the research, it was found that birds have 2.93 times higherintensity of basal metabolism compared to cattleor by 0.199 MJ/kg. It is required 23% more gross energy of plant feed for production of one MJ of milknutritional value than for an egg product. Highly productive animals havemore effective basic metabolism and high efficiency of interaction between the main processes of metabolic energy usage. Field experiments were carried out in the period from 2018 to 2020 in the grain-grass crop rotation of the laboratory of perennial and medicinal herbs of Ulyanovsk Research Institute of Agriculture. The main purpose of the research is to develop theoretical and practical foundations for formation of highly productive, cost-effective agrophytocenoses of dyeing safflower of Ershovskiy -4variety, taking into account the agroclimatic conditions of the Middle Volga region, as well as to establish formation features of the harvest structure elements and seed productivity under the influence of agrochemical components. For comparison, sowing methods were used in combination with seeding amounts: continuous row (15 cm spacing), wide-row (30 cm spacing) and wide-row (70 cm spacing), each of which had four seeding amounts (from 200 thousand/ha to 700 thousand/ha). The seeding amount for wide-row (70 cm row spacing) sowing method is from 250 thousand / ha to 400 thousand / ha. Ammonium nitrate N30fertilizer was introduced as a background for presowing cultivation. Maximum seed yield of 9.0 dt/ha was formed by plants of wide-row sowing method. This practiceallowedto increase the yield on average by 25.5% in comparison with skip-row sowing, and by 29.2% with row sowing. Yield increase occurred both due to increase ofplant bushiness of wide-row sowing, and increase of the mass of seeds of productive heads.
